The Opportunity
Unity's advertising platform reaches billions of consumers each month across mobile apps, games, and connected TV. We're growing our UK Agency and Brand Partnerships team and looking for a driven, commercially sharp Sales Executive to own a named patch of agency and brand accounts across the UK market. This is a quota-carrying, individual contributor role. You'll work a defined set of agency holding company offices, independent agencies, and brand direct accounts — building relationships, running a structured sales process, and closing programmatic and managed service deals. You won't be managing people; you'll be focused on becoming the go-to Unity rep in the UK market.
The right person has ad tech or programmatic sales experience, already has working relationships across UK agencies or brands, and has sold brand advertising into or alongside the mobile gaming ecosystem — whether that's in-app, gaming audiences, or mobile-first programmatic. You're motivated by owning a number and growing it. You'll be the sole Unity seller in market, which means a lot of autonomy — and a real opportunity to shape how Unity shows up in the UK.
What You'll Do
- Own a named portfolio of agency holding company offices, independent agencies, and brand direct accounts across the UK; carry a quarterly and annual revenue quota and consistently work to achieve it.
- Run a structured sales process from first contact to close: prospecting and qualification, needs discovery, proposal and media plan development, deal negotiation, and revenue expansion within existing accounts.
- Build working relationships across your patch — with media planners, programmatic traders, investment leads, and digital strategists — so Unity is included in planning conversations.
- Present and position Unity's advertising solutions clearly and consultatively: managed service campaigns, PMPs, Programmatic Guaranteed deals, and Audience Hub data activations, matched to client KPIs and buying infrastructure.
- Respond to agency RFPs with well-crafted, insight-led proposals; lead pitches and client meetings with confidence.
- Keep account plans current: document key contacts, map spend pools, track open opportunities, and flag expansion potential.
- Represent Unity at industry events and use market presence to grow your network and pipeline.
- Collaborate with internal teams — account management, solutions, and marketing — to deliver for clients and feed insights back into the business.
What We're Looking For
Required
- Experience in programmatic, mobile, or digital advertising sales, with a track record of meeting or exceeding revenue targets.
- Existing relationships with UK agency planners, traders, or brand teams.
- Solid working knowledge of how programmatic deals are bought and structured: DSPs, SSPs, PMPs, open auction, and managed service.
- Experience running a full sales cycle independently, from prospecting through close.
- Direct, hands-on experience selling in-app, mobile gaming, and programmatic advertising.
- Strong communication skills — clear in writing, confident in meetings, credible in a pitch.
- Organised and self-directed; able to manage a pipeline and prioritise without close supervision.
- Based in or willing to relocate to London; comfortable being in-market with clients regularly.
Nice to Have
- CTV advertising experience.
- Familiarity with brand-performance convergence, retail media, or commerce media buying.
- Experience at a mobile SSP, DSP, or ad network.
